#cee344 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cee344 is composed of 80.8% red, 89%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 70%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 67.9 degrees, a saturation of 74% and a lightness of 57.8%. #cee344 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ff88 with #9dc700.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#cee344 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cee344 has RGB values of R:206, G:227,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0, Y:0.7,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 13558596.
